Mrs Danks, widow of the author of the Song “Silver Threads Among the Gold” has died at the age of 82, poor and unhappy. The proceeds of the song, amounting to fifteen thousand sterling, led to the wrecking of the home. Deceased’s husband died in poverty twenty years ago. Later a copy of a song was found upon which lie had written “It’s hard to grow old alone.” Two daughters and a son quarrelled over the royalties from the song, and one surviving daughter is still at enmity with the brother. EXCHANGE RATE. THE RISE OF THE FRANC. 'Received this day at 8 a.m.) NEW YORK, March 22. 'lhe franc is selling strongly and has reached five and three-tenths cents representing within forty-eight hours a gain of two-Vnths cents. THE £1 STERLING UNSTEADY. (Received this day at 8 a.rn.) NEW YORK, -March 22. Sterling, however, is unsteady, and has declined two cents, reaching 428 g. The Continental Exchange has remained relatively stationary, hut the chervonets lias reached 020 cents which is six cents above par. Observers believe the franc’s ascendancy is certain in some months, but its ultimate late depends on France's fiscal reform measures.
ANOTHER DEBT SETTLED. WASHINGTON. March 22. Senator Mellon lias announced that Finland has completed the funding of her nine million dollars debt to the United States for relief supplies furnished since the armistice. This tvansacthion completes the second debt settlement, Britain’s being first.
